Personally, I'm looking for villains that provoke interesting choices. Not necessarily just "which of my powers/cards will I use to hurt them". More innate in the villain, such as effects that say I can let effect A happen or I can let effect B happen, where both are Bad Things(TM) with not-insignificant downstream impacts, and our decision will guide our chance of success. When a villain does that, I'm much more interested and invested in the game, because it's my decisions that are making a difference. (And I'll acknowledge that having interesting targets creates that kind of decision making, as you have to decide where to focus, but we already have lots of those kinds of villains.)
